PARTNERSHIPS MAKE IT POSSIBLE Maple Valley’s progress is built on strong partnerships. “No city can do it alone,” says Mayor Kelly.“We work with Black Diamond, Covington, King County, our state representatives, and community organizations like the Rotary and Chamber of Commerce.” State Representative Lisa Callan, co-chair of the state capital projects committee, has been instrumental in securing transportation funding. Through the Chamber’s SEAL initiative, more than $1 billion has been invested in Highway 18 and 990. “That’s economic development,” Mayor Kelly notes. “It’s about building roads to move commerce.” McIntyre recalls a conversation with Shawn Norris of Bigfoot Football Club: “He told me he could have gone to Kent or Auburn, but he chose Maple Valley because of the opportunities and the community. He wanted to invest where he knew it would make a difference.” Saas agrees. “What makes Maple Valley unique is how quickly the community rallies to support a need.
